Ebola Spread in DR Congo Sparks Alarm as Cases Surge Beyond 1,000

The Ebola spread in DR Congo has reached a critical stage, with health experts warning that the outbreak is expanding faster than response efforts can keep pace. Just weeks after the outbreak was officially declared, suspected infections have already crossed the 1,000 mark, prompting urgent calls for stronger containment measures and international support.

Medical teams working on the ground describe the situation as one of the most concerning Ebola outbreaks in recent years. The rapid increase in cases, combined with ongoing security challenges and limited access to affected communities, has raised fears that the disease could continue spreading across borders if immediate action is not taken.

Key Highlights

  • More than 1,000 suspected Ebola cases reported in DR Congo.
  • At least 246 deaths linked to the outbreak.
  • Neighboring Uganda has confirmed infections and a fatality.
  • Health workers warn the true scale may be larger due to testing delays.
  • Conflict and transportation restrictions are slowing response efforts.
  • International health agencies are increasing monitoring and containment measures.

Ebola Spread in DR Congo Accelerates Rapidly

Health officials say the Ebola spread in DR Congo has accelerated at an alarming pace since the outbreak was declared earlier this month. Medical teams are reporting new suspected cases daily, creating growing pressure on already stretched healthcare systems.

The eastern province of Ituri remains the center of the outbreak, accounting for the majority of reported infections. Communities across the region are facing increasing concern as authorities work to trace contacts, isolate patients, and prevent further transmission.

Experts note that Ebola outbreaks are particularly dangerous when early detection and rapid isolation measures are delayed. In the current situation, the speed of new infections has outpaced testing capacity in several affected areas.

Health Experts Warn of Serious Challenges

Doctors and humanitarian organizations have expressed concern that the outbreak may be significantly larger than official figures suggest.

One major issue is the backlog of laboratory testing. Hundreds of samples reportedly remain unprocessed, making it difficult for health authorities to determine the full scale of the crisis. Without accurate data, response teams face challenges in allocating resources effectively.

Healthcare workers also continue to face logistical barriers while trying to reach remote communities. Limited infrastructure, transportation difficulties, and security concerns have complicated efforts to provide medical assistance where it is needed most.

Major Obstacles Facing Response Teams

  • Delays in laboratory testing.
  • Limited access to remote communities.
  • Security concerns caused by regional instability.
  • Shortages of medical resources.
  • Difficulties tracking potential contacts.
  • Border and transportation restrictions.

These challenges have slowed containment efforts during a period when rapid action is critical.

Rising Death Toll Raises Concerns

The growing death toll has intensified concerns among international health organizations. According to available reports, at least 246 people have died during the outbreak.

Ebola is a severe viral disease that can spread through direct contact with infected bodily fluids. Symptoms often include:

  • Fever
  • Severe weakness
  • Headaches
  • Muscle pain
  • V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Internal and external bleeding in severe cases

Early diagnosis and supportive medical care can improve survival rates, making timely detection a crucial component of outbreak management.

Uganda Reports Confirmed Cases

The outbreak is no longer confined to DR Congo. Health authorities in neighboring Uganda have already confirmed multiple Ebola infections and reported at least one death.

Cross-border movement remains a significant concern because communities in the region frequently travel between countries for trade, work, and family connections. Public health officials are therefore increasing surveillance at border crossings and transportation hubs.

The emergence of cases outside DR Congo highlights the importance of coordinated regional action to prevent wider transmission.

Conflict Complicates Containment Efforts

One of the biggest challenges facing healthcare workers is the ongoing Ebola spread in DR Congo.

Armed conflict and security concerns have affected humanitarian operations for years in the region. Medical teams often face difficulties reaching affected communities safely, while some residents may hesitate to seek treatment because of security fears.

The combination of a fast-moving disease outbreak and an unstable security environment creates particularly difficult conditions for health authorities attempting to contain the virus.

Impact of Conflict on Healthcare Response

  • Delayed emergency medical deployments.
  • Reduced access to affected villages.
  • Challenges transporting medical supplies.
  • Difficulty conducting contact tracing.
  • Increased risks for healthcare workers.

These factors can significantly slow efforts to interrupt chains of transmission.

International Health Agencies Intensify Response

Global health organizations are working closely with local authorities to strengthen containment measures.

Emergency response efforts include:

  1. Expanding testing capacity.
  2. Increasing surveillance activities.
  3. Deploying additional healthcare workers.
  4. Improving public awareness campaigns.
  5. Supporting treatment facilities.
  6. Enhancing border monitoring.

Public health experts stress that rapid coordination between national governments, humanitarian organizations, and local communities will be essential to controlling the outbreak.

Why the Outbreak Is Drawing Global Attention

The Ebola spread in DR Congo is attracting international concern because of the unusually rapid increase in suspected cases shortly after the outbreak declaration.

Historically, early intervention plays a major role in limiting Ebola outbreaks. When infections rise quickly before containment systems are fully established, the risk of wider transmission increases substantially.

Health officials are particularly focused on preventing additional cross-border spread while improving testing and treatment access within affected regions.

Importance of Community Awareness

Public education remains one of the most effective tools for controlling Ebola outbreaks.

Health authorities continue encouraging residents to:

  • Report symptoms immediately.
  • Avoid direct contact with infected individuals.
  • Follow hygiene recommendations.
  • Cooperate with contact tracing teams.
  • Seek medical care as early as possible.

Community engagement helps health workers identify cases more quickly and reduce opportunities for further transmission.

Outlook for the Coming Weeks

The coming weeks will likely be critical in determining whether the outbreak can be brought under control.

While response efforts are expanding, experts caution that the situation remains highly uncertain due to testing delays, security challenges, and the continued emergence of new suspected cases. The ability of healthcare teams to rapidly identify infections and isolate patients will play a major role in shaping the outbreak’s trajectory.

For now, the Ebola spread in DR Congo remains a major public health concern, with authorities racing to strengthen containment measures before the outbreak grows even larger.
